Gio Ponti Grand Console Table in Cherry with Red Marble Top ca 1958

Evan Lobel

Grand console table in cherry with red marble top, suspended glass shelf and brass sabots by Gio Ponti for a residence in Bologna, Italy ca 1958. The craftsmanship of this beautiful console is remarkable. An iconic design by one of Italy’s most important 20th century designers.

Reference:
This console table sold at Wright Auction, Important Design (Day 2), May 20, 2008. In the auction it states that is was authenticated by the Gio Ponti Archives.

Philip & Kelvin LaVerne Rare "Les Chinois" Cocktail Table 1970s (Signed) - SOLD

Evan Lobel

main.jpg

Rare "Les Chinois” Cocktail Table with 4 legs engraved with Chinese scenes in patinated bronze and pewter with hand-painted colorful enamels by Philip & Kelvin LaVerne, American 1970's (signed in 3 places). This coffee table is very rare. Kelvin LaVerne states that only a few were made. The Chinese iconography and coloration on the legs are superb. The legs were bent into shape by hand.

Reference:
ALCHEMY: THE ART OF PHILIP AND KELVIN LAVERNE written by Evan Lobel with Kelvin LaVerne, published by Pointed Leaf Press in 2024, this table is shown on pages 64-65 in the section titled Historical Civilization Series. The caption from the LaVerne catalog reads, “The LES CHINOIS coffee table was created in the 1970s. The LaVenes were constantly experimenting with different ways to showcase their artistic skills. Here, the engraved and hand-colored scenes are on the legs, which had to be bent into shape by hand. The tabletop shows the LaVerne patina which was obtained by burying it underground.”

Philip & Kelvin LaVerne Rare "Eternal Forest" Coffee Table 1972 - SOLD

Evan Lobel

main.jpg

"Eternal Forest" coffee table in patinated and engraved bronze and pewter with hand painted enamels by Philip and Kelvin LaVerne, American 1972 (signed Philip + Kelvin LaVerne on top). This rare table is an incredible work of art with its organic repeating natural motif. It’s one of their most enchanting works of art.

Reference:
ALCHEMY: THE ART OF PHILIP AND KELVIN LAVERNE written by Evan Lobel with Kelvin LaVerne, published by Pointed Leaf Press in 2024, Eternal Forest tables are shown on pages 120-121 in the section titled The Abstract Series. The caption reads, “Created in the 1960s, the ETERNAL FOREST table is described in the Philip and Kelvin LaVerne, Sculpture III catalog, published in the 1970s: ”Symbol of the continuity of life and growth, a peaceful unending forest stands before us. Hand-sculptured of bronze and pewter, with delicate tones of natural patinas.”
